Kallar Kahar: Two people lost their lives after the motorcycle they were riding was hit and crushed by a trawler on Bharpoor Road in Kallar Kahar near PAF base, police and rescuers said.
The victims have been identified as 22-year-old Sami Ullah Sakin and 27-year-old Shah Wali who were residents of Thoha Bahadar village.
The bodies were shifted to Trauma Centre Kallar Kahar by Rescue 1122 ambulances for legal formalities. Police are investigating the incident.
